Is Terrace Park a good place to live?
Terrace Park is a good place to live. Terrace Park is considered somewhat walkable and very bikeable with minimal transit options. Terrace Park is a neighborhood with a crime score of 4, on par with the average neighborhood in the U.S. Terrace Park has 6 parks for recreational activities. It is fairly sparse in population with 4.0 people per acre and a median age of 40. The average household income is $62,530 which is below the national average. College graduates make up 18.2% of residents. A majority of residents in Terrace Park are renters, with 63% of residents renting and 37%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in Terrace Park?
The median home price in Terrace Park is $215,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$43,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.49%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$1,090 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$47K a year to afford the median home price in Terrace Park.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ator. The average household income in Terrace Park is $63K.
